Onboarding: TwigSweep, our stale-branch cleanup bot. TwigSweep scans all Harrowdale repos nightly and flags branches inactive for 60 days; after a 14-day grace period with two notifications, it archives them. Protected branches and anything matching the release pattern are exempt. Repo owners can extend the grace period per branch. For the weekly eng sync, review the archive report and exemption requests, which are posted on the internal dashboard page here.

wiki page, tahaf-tajog: https://jira.ordindyn.corp/pipeline

// Shipping-fee rules engine client.
// Connects to Fareforge, the internal rules service that evaluates
// per-carton fee matrices at checkout. Release builds must pin the
// ruleset version; floating versions caused the Parcelton incident.
// Client is read-only — rule edits go through the admin console, not
// this path. Timeouts: 150ms, two retries. The service credential
// used by this client is set below.

service key, fawip-bajef: kto11_Qt5wZK9vdNC

### Runbook: BounceBroom — Account Recovery

If the BounceBroom email bounce processor loses access to its service account, do not create a new one. First, pause the intake queue so bounces buffer safely. Then open the recovery console and select the BounceBroom principal. Verification requires approval from the on-call lead. Once approved, the console prompts for the stored recovery credentials; enter the passphrase that appears directly below this paragraph.

recovery phrase for fahof-kahap: holion-gormir-jorix-istix-briwyn-sorael

For the weekly sync: we evaluated permessage-deflate versus the custom Skellen dictionary scheme. Deflate cuts bandwidth ~55% on chat payloads but adds 8–12ms latency per frame and raised memory per connection by about 30KB, which matters at our 200k-connection ceiling. Decision so far: enable deflate only for connections flagged low-frequency; high-frequency trading feeds stay uncompressed. Load tests on the Marwick cluster finish Thursday. Final tradeoff call and rollout timing rest with the engineer named below.

account owner for bawip-tahag: Raleth Quenok